我是靠谱客的博主 雪白面包,最近开发中收集的这篇文章主要介绍【仿真+实测】一篇文章搞定RC延迟电路 1.延迟开启 2.快速泄放 3.精确泄放,觉得挺不错的,现在分享给大家,希望可以做个参考。

概述

cf336b925906dba48cc96853613b5b66.jpeg

 作者:面向搜索,排版:晓宇

微信公众号:芯片之家(ID:chiphome-dy)

RC延迟电路

在许多芯片的应用手册中都要求了对上电时序进行控制,在这种场合下我们会经常看到RC延迟,今天我们通过multisim 14.0 对RC延迟计算电路的理论计算进行仿真验证

Multisim软件版本

99bc5224be5ea16da60cbfcac3b6085c.png

附上multisim 14.0 网盘链接,内附PJ方法

https://pan.baidu.com/s/15NvcyeKIgk-COlvoDIfz0A
提取码: dsmf

RC延迟上电计算公式

充电公式:T=RCln((U-Uc)/U)

放电公式:T= - R C ln(Uc/U)

d86ddf53c31cd4829858e90251fa83bf.png

U为上电电压(电源电压);Uc为电容充到T时刻的电压;T为充电时间。

充电↓

当t= RC时,电容电压Uc=0.63*电源电压U;

当t= 2RC时,电容电压Uc=0.86*电源电压U;

当t= 3RC时,电容电压Uc=0.95*电源电压U;

当t= 4RC时,电容电压Uc=0.98*电源电压U;

当t= 5RC时,电容电压Uc=0.99*电源电压U。

放电↓

当t=RC时,Vt=0.368*电源电压U;

当t=2RC时,Vt=0.135424*电源电压U;

当t=3RC时,Vt=0.04984*电源电压U;

当t=4RC时,Vt=0.01834*电源电压U;

当t=5RC时,Vt=0.006749*电源电压U。

仿真验证

c67c08641a2c03a3eaf2a20276d94ee0.png

d9d91e8aa7a3b03f332b9a32e6fa332d.png

当充电到 0.8倍 VCC时,通过理论计算可知:t = RC*ln(0.2) = 16ms

和仿真结果基本相同

RC充电的过程讲完了,在电机控制等场合下我们要求三极管等开关器件关断速度要快,但是在应用RC上电延迟电路后,其关断时间也会延长,如下图所示,这是不行的。

b9918058d7ae03d2d01d10fe17a88d83.png

下电延迟

下电延迟会和计算值相差比较大,这是因为当断电时有一部分放电电流通过三极管释放,所以无法通过准确计算预知,我们接着看,如何解决这个问题呢?下面我将介绍一款新的电路解决这个问题。

快速泄放的RC延迟电路

在电机控制等场合下我们要求三极管等开关器件关断速度要快,但是在应用RC上电延迟电路后,其关断时间也会延长,如下图所示,这是不行的。所以引出我们的快速泄放的RC延迟电路↓

快速泄放的RC延迟电路工作原理

5268a5b5af630cccd9ac65d02260fc62.png

相对于之前的电路,引入了D3、D2、Q2、R4。

当S1断开,此电路如何实现快速放电的呢?

由于D2的存在,C1中的电荷通过D2快速通向Q2的E,此时E级约为11V;S1断开R4的存在使Q2的B为低,则Q2导通,则C1中的电荷通过D2、Q2快速泄放,泄放完毕后Q2、Q1均断开。

当S1闭合时,D3导通,此时Q2 B级为12V、E级为11.3V这保证了此时Q2处于未导通状态。电流通过D3和RC延迟电路使得Q1可正常导通。

我们来看一下结果(关断的延迟缩短为 1ms )

adfb1d5d9d2d0eb399189fc74d7d5fe8.png

b8f9a61dfb1016b95088160873234d50.png

d1956737136c010a467bda779a5f83e4.png

通过验证结果可以看到已经达到了快速泄放的目的

进一步的改进

在下图中 增加了稳压管D1,在C1充电到Vz之前,D1不会导通,只有在C1电压超过Vz时,Q1才会导通,这样会减少Q1开关过程中通过放大区的时间,减少不必要的开关损耗。

4825929720eaa25b434faa8011be73cb.png

精确泄放的RC延迟电路

在某些场合需要精确控制下电时间,这时简单的RC就无法满足。

简单的加一个二极管就实现下电时间的精确控制,二极管正向导通,反向截至,所以电容上的电只会通过泄放电阻R2释放。(当开关使用三极管控制时,二极管阻断从三极管的放电回路,只通过R2放电,这就保证了下电的精确延迟!)

eef63a8600e523f28ec939cae3ea6c9a.png

经验公式:达到下降至0.368Vcc时需要 T= RC = 66ms。

图片可以放大看,从仿真结果可以看出,放电和充电的时间与经验公式一致。

结束

今天介绍了RC延迟电路和与其配合使用的快速泄放、精确泄放电路。原理虽然不难但是在一些芯片上电时序控制、电机控制的场合下还是非常实用的

最后,关于电路的学习,希望大家,enjoy!跪求 点赞并转发  支持我们,您的转发就是我们继续创作的最佳动力,谢谢大家!本文由芯片之家11群网友 面向搜索 授权原创发表,感谢!

2adb599b32a9104d4e5cf7d29f114919.gif

‍往期推荐☆

ceed1b8e58026607909a318c1a8d2ad6.jpeg

真实案例分享:MOS管电源开关电路,遇到上电冲击电流超标

d39792e8a52d3651397b43ed0506c8c6.jpeg

晓宇姐姐带你软硬结合,感受下ADC DMA采集多路电压电流的最佳姿势

8d359450a061f09de7d901158740accb.jpeg

经典深度分析!ESP8266/ESP32自动下载电路究竟是如何巧妙实现的

8218b34c4dbd5bd0196afeb4b53754f8.jpeg

看似简单的光耦电路,实际使用中应该注意些什么?

最后

以上就是雪白面包为你收集整理的【仿真+实测】一篇文章搞定RC延迟电路 1.延迟开启 2.快速泄放 3.精确泄放的全部内容,希望文章能够帮你解决【仿真+实测】一篇文章搞定RC延迟电路 1.延迟开启 2.快速泄放 3.精确泄放所遇到的程序开发问题。

如果觉得靠谱客网站的内容还不错,欢迎将靠谱客网站推荐给程序员好友。

本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
点赞(47)

评论列表共有 0 条评论

立即
投稿
返回
顶部